At DIVEBNB, we support DAN, the Divers Alert Network, the world’s most recognized and respected diving safety organization.DAN has remained committed to the health and well-being of divers for 40+ years.The organization’s research, medical services, and global- response programs create an extensive network that supports divers with vital services.DAN offers both short term dive accident coverage and annual coverage options for divers.1. Insurance Premium & Support InformationDAN insurance premiums are set at a fixed amount based on the coverage you select.By signing up through us (DIVEBNB), we can provide direct assistance in the event of an emergency.However, all insurance claims require basic supporting documentation, such as an accident summary, medical receipts, and hospital bills.In practice, direct filing of claims is typically faster, so we recommend this method in most cases.(DAN's system processes claims more quickly when submitted directly by members.)2. Coverage & Claim CasesCompensation amounts vary depending on the plan selected. Rather than a fixed amount for each accident type,the actual costs incurred are paid within the plan's maximum coverage limit.For example:Decompression accidents, hospital transfers, and recompression chamber transfers are covered under Emergency Medical Transportation, with a maximum coverage of USD 150,000 under the DAN Short-Term Plan.Actual payment amounts are calculated based on submitted receipts and supporting documentation.Furthermore, medical and surgical treatment required after a diving accident is covered under Dive Accident Medical Expenses, with a maximum coverage limit of USD 125,000.Payment is also based on actual costs incurred and the supporting documentation submitted.(Jiny herself filed a claim directly with DAN after a past diving accident and received a full refund of the expenses she submitted.)DAN Short-Term Diving Accident Insurance – Coverage SummaryUSD 150,000 – Emergency Medical TransportationUSD 125,000 – Dive Accident Medical ExpensesUSD 10,000 – Death and Disability Due to InjuryUSD 1,000 – Additional Transportation ExpensesUSD 1,000 – Additional Accommodation Expenses3. Easy Sign-Up & 24/7 Emergency SupportThe sign-up process is very simple, and you can easily follow the short instructional videos we've prepared.In an emergency, it's crucial to contact the DAN hotline immediately.The DAN hotline is open 24 hours a day and provides the following support:Information on the nearest hospital or recompression chamberMedical transport or emergency evacuation assistanceReal-time coordination with local facilities and medical staffImmediate assistance from a specialized emergency response teamDAN helps divers receive prompt, specialized treatment anywhere in the world.Another contact option is the international emergency number +1-919-684-9111, which is also available 24/7.

24/7 Emergency HotlineDAN World’s emergency hotline is ready to assist 24 hours a day, 365 days a year in the event of a dive accident or incident.+1-919-684-9111 (English)+52-557-100-0540 (Spanish)+62-21-5085-8719 (Indonesia)+60-15-4600-0109 (Malaysia)+63-02-8231-3601 (Philippines)+66-1800-01-8092 (Thailand)
